This painting presents a vibrant and vertical urban scene, where the architecture rises like a dense network of shapes and planes that seem to overlap in a visual choreography full of rhythm. The facades of the buildings, narrow and tall, create an urban corridor that leads the gaze to the background, generating a sense of depth and dynamism. The slightly compressed perspective intensifies the proximity between the elements, giving the impression of a bustling and lively street, where every corner hides a detail to discover.
The colors used in the composition combine neutral and muted tones with more intense accents in the signs and posters that populate the façades. These signs, with words suggesting shops, bars, and services, add a everyday and recognizable character to the environment. The repetition of rectangular and vertical shapes in the posters reinforces the structure of the whole, while introducing chromatic and visual variety, becoming points of interest that break the monotony of the buildings.
At the bottom of the scene, the presence of human figures adds a narrative dimension that humanizes the space. These figures, represented in a simple manner and without excessive detail, seem to walk along the sidewalk, integrating into the city’s daily life. Their scale, in relation to the buildings, highlights the monumentality of the urban environment and underscores the sense that the architecture dominates the space, while people inhabit it transiently.
The vehicle that appears in the foreground helps situate the scene in a concrete temporal context, suggesting a period in which automobile design had a characteristic aesthetic. Its inclusion not only provides an additional narrative element but also introduces a gentle curve that contrasts with the rigidity of the vertical and rectangular lines of the rest of the composition. This contrast helps balance the image, offering a visual respite within the structural density.
The light in the painting seems diffused, with no clearly defined source, allowing colors and shapes to integrate harmoniously. There are no harsh shadows or extreme contrasts, which reinforces a tranquil atmosphere despite the urban setting. This softness in lighting contributes to a sense of nostalgia or evocation, as if the scene captured a moment suspended in time, closer to memory than to immediate reality.
Overall, the work conveys the essence of urban life through a composition rich in detail, where architecture, everyday signs, and human presence intertwine to create a scene full of character, rhythm, and evocation.
